In the latest wave of development, HRMI has introduced Psychology as a mandatory course module to the Certificate in HR programme which provides very useful insights for potential HR professionals to learn Psychology and connect human behaviour with HR. This is the first instance where psychology has been included in a HR Certificate course as a major component. The addition of Psychology not only enriches the learning but also opens up a totally new dimension in HR studies. The students will be exposed to Counselling and Organisational Psychology which could lead to many new opportunities in employment and practice.
The Certificate in HR with Psychology is open for students with GCE O/L and provides a seamless pathway to pursue the internationally recognised Pearson Assured Diploma in HR as well as the BSc degree in Business and Management from University of Derby in UK. What do parents and children have to look when it comes to professional education? (1) Qualification must be respected and recognised, (2) Qualification must provide progression opportunities (3) Qualification content must be comprehensive and delivered by qualified professionals (4) Qualification must be linked for employment (5) Qualification provider must have a holistic perspective for student development.
